Tarnwick's user-profile store is sharded by stable account hash across twelve partitions, each with its own encryption key managed by the Coldbridge key service. Cross-shard reads go through the Lattice router, which enforces tenant isolation and strips internal routing headers. Rebalancing is operator-initiated only and logged to the immutable audit stream. For review purposes, note that restoring a shard snapshot to a clean partition requires unlocking the shard keyring, which expects the phrase below.

vault phrase of yagag-kadup = belael-druius-rusax-kelox

## Runbook: Gaugepile Sidecar — Release Checklist

Heads up: the sidecar ships with every app pod, so a bad config fans out fast. Before cutting a release, confirm the flush interval hasn't drifted from what the Tallyhouse aggregator expects, or you'll see sawtooth gaps in dashboards. Rollbacks are cheap — just repin the image tag. Canary one node pool first, watch for ten minutes, then proceed. The values to verify against are these.

config for bagep-yafof:
quenath:
  pin: 8584
  metrics_host: metrics.quenath.tolvaqsys.internal
  tenant: pelath
  seal: seal_ed102645

- [ ] Locker assignment, changing rooms (Level B1)

New starter reports to the Harwick Lane facilities desk before 10:00. Confirm induction form signed. Assign next free locker from the Tansley block, log number in the register, hand over padlock. Remind them wet kit goes in the drying cage, not the locker. Issue the changing-room door code below:

badge for hahip-bagag: bdg-FIJ-9

## Read-Replica Lag Alarm

New folks: the ReplicaLagHigh alarm covers the Ostrel reporting replicas. It fires when lag exceeds 90 seconds for five minutes. Most triggers come from the nightly Bramwell export job, which is expected and auto-resolves. Do not fail over the replica yourself — that requires the data-platform lead's approval and a change ticket. If the alarm persists past 20 minutes with no export running, write to the platform inbox.

billing contact of yahip-yadup = eliax.druix@zemvarworks.corp